What does “mochila” mean in English?

  1. backpack

Example sentences

  • Pongo los libros en la mochila.

    I put the books in my backpack.

  • Mi mochila es muy grande.

    My backpack is very big.

  • Compré una mochila nueva.

    I bought a new backpack.

How to use it

Mochila means 'backpack' / 'rucksack'. Feminine: la mochila. Plural mochilas. Standard student / hiker word.

Common mistake

Don't confuse mochila with bolsa (bag) or maleta (suitcase). Mochila is specifically the backpack-style bag with two straps.
